Markus Schatz is one of the Berlin originals, has been playing for many years in the Berlin club scene, including 7 years as a Tresor resident, and producing music himself since 2004. He translates his enthusiasm for the many diverse faces of electronic music into complex productions that provide his sets a tingly mix of deep house elements, impulsive percussion-styles and clear minimal-beats. With his keen sense of the dancefloor dynamics, Markus Schatz always gets his compositions to the point where the dancing crowd reacts wildly. Alex Kiefer's sound is a mix between minimal/tech-house and sometimes trancy influences. In 2007 he received his first bookings in clubs like Rosis, Villa and Morlox. Today he plays at the hottest clubs all over the world, presenting his excessive and explosive DJ sets. He manages one of the main minimal labels in germany "Code2 Records" and also runs the sublabel "Taldor Records" but he also works together with other labels like Indalo, Gemini and BDivision. Oliver Markreich aka Cur.l creates experimental housy productions. He found his own unique style between house mininmal and techno and he improves permanently over the years. In the time he lived in Switzerland and Lake Constance he became well-known as house DJ in clubs like Douala or Dome and he was also travelling for 3 weeks to Ibiza playing in clubs like Blue Marlin.
